A few months ago, I mentioned to DriveThruRPG’s Matt McElroy (also of Flames Rising) about doing something for National Child Abuse Prevention Month. Matt was immediately amenable to the idea and went about rounding up participants for a charity bundle.
Here it is now, officially launched, and what a bundle it is!
I donated my own Little Fears Nightmare Edition Book 2: Among the Missing. It sits alongside:
World of Darkness: Innocents
KidWorld
Teenagers from Outer Space
The Play’s the Thing
BASH! Ultimate Edition
Adventures in Wonderland
Adventures in Oz Character Pack
…and much more!
All for just $25, which goes to one of the best causes out there: helping the innocent. I hope you’ll consider making a donation and helping out a cause very close to my heart.

Season Two of Campfire Tales wrapped up last week with the release of #6: Old Man Winter. That brings the total number of products in the Nightmare Edition line to eight. I’m pretty proud of that. LFNE went a year after its release without additional material until the first Campfire Tales episode launched in October 2010. While I wasn’t able to pump out the 12 episodes I’d initially planned, I was able to readjust for the stutter in my workflow and publish half of them in about a year’s time along with the first full-sized supplement as well.
I ramped up my writing on all fronts this past year, contributing to other game lines and a very exciting video game project, and I look to continuing the trend in 2012. As some of you might know, I’ll be dedicating a good chunk of the first quarter to my new project Streets of Bedlam but Little Fears is a long-time love of mine and I have no intention of leaving it in the cold. On the contrary, I have some big plans for the property.
Last March, I revealed some information about a multi-part supplement called The Seven Kings. I’ve also dropped some hints about Book 3 here and there. I’d still love to do both next year but won’t commit to a time frame just yet. I’ll keep you all posted.
One thing I do want to announce now is that I’ll be releasing a summer season of Campfire Tales. The three episodes will be set in the hottest months which gives me a good excuse to finally release one of my personal favorite episodes, “Camp Howling Wolf.” I look forward to the change in season and I hope you like it as well.
Other plans for Little Fears exist, some more feasible than others, but I’ll hold tight on those yet. One promise at a time.
I want to thank you all for your support, your kind words, and helping to spread the word. I hope you had a wonderful year and an even better one awaits you in 2012.

The newest Campfire Tale is now available on DriveThruRPG and RPGNow:

Winter has come and with it—wait, where’s the snow? It’s almost the end of December and not a flake has fallen. While initially dismissed as simply an unseasonable warm spell, a curious admission from the neighborhood goody-two-shoes reveals there may be something nefarious at work here. Think you’re up for saving an entire season?
As with all the Campfire Tales, “Old Man Winter” is just $2 for a full standalone episode including a new monster and four new GMCs for use with this or any Little Fears Nightmare Edition episode.
I hope you enjoy this new episode! If you get a chance to play it, please let me know what you think.

The newest Campfire Tale is now available on DriveThruRPG and RPGNow:

Kids can be so cruel. And while some scars fade with time, some wounds never heal. These cut so deep, their pain lingers even beyond death. On this quiet Fall day in the neighborhood of Hansom Creek, a past victim of local cruelty comes back to seek revenge on her tormentors. Those wicked children will pay for their crimes.
Something evil is on the wind.
As with all the Campfire Tales, “Dead Leaves” is just $2 for a full standalone episode including two new monsters and four new GMCs for use with this or any Little Fears Nightmare Edition episode.
I hope you enjoy this new episode! If you get a chance to play it, please let me know what you think.
